Nsoatreman FC on Sunday will host the in-form King Faisal at the Nana Kronmansah Park in Nsuatre for their week 27 Ghana Premier League fixture.
After suffering a loss to Hearts of Oak last weekend, the Nsoatre-based team is determined to get back on the winning track.
However, they have been unconvincing in their last five matches, winning just one, drawing one, and losing three. Meanwhile, King Faisal has won three of their last four games.
Presently, Nsoatreman FC is in the relegation zone, occupying the 16th position with 31 points from 26 matches.
They are trailing King Faisal by four points and hoping to secure a victory that will move them out of the relegation zone.
On the other hand, Ignatius Osei Fosu’s King Faisal team is seeking to maintain their impressive form since he took over as coach.
They will strive to avoid a loss that could put them in jeopardy in the relegation battle. King Faisal is currently positioned in the 11th spot in the league standings with 35 points.
